The Year for Irrational Hope: Debbie Millman on the 10-Year Plan

About this episode

In the second episode of our January series, The Year for Irrational Hope, Leah Smart sits down with legendary designer, author, educator, and podcast host Debbie Millman to explore the power of the 10-year plan. Originally taught to Debbie by her mentor Milton Glaser, this visioning exercise is about suspending limiting beliefs and imagining an ideal day ten years from now without worrying about how it will happen. Debbie shares how it shaped her career, creativity, and personal life, and why declaring hope can quietly set real change in motion. This conversation invites you to think bigger, let go of outdated identities, and make room for who you’re becoming.
